Born in Ipatinga, in the Brazilian state of Minas Gerais, Lucas spent his formative years surrounded by family and the values of discipline, faith and hard work. Although his early ambitions centred upon education rather than entertainment, his curiosity and desire to challenge himself eventually led him to study Petroleum Engineering after relocating to Espírito Santo. Yet even while pursuing an academic path, opportunities within the modelling industry began to emerge, revealing a future he had never imagined for himself. Following the completion of his studies, Lucas moved to Belo Horizonte, where he began modelling professionally. Possessing both striking physical presence and unwavering determination, he quickly distinguished himself within Brazil's highly competitive fashion industry. His efforts were rewarded in 2015 when he earned the prestigious title of Mister Brasil, an achievement that immediately elevated his profile on the national stage. The following year he expanded that success internationally by winning the coveted Mister World title, placing Brazil once again at the forefront of global male pageantry and opening doors to campaigns, editorial work and international recognition. The turning point of his career arrived in 2019 when he entered the eleventh season of A Fazenda, one of Brazil's most watched reality television programmes. Throughout the competition Lucas displayed remarkable resilience, overcoming challenges while forming memorable bonds with both fellow contestants and the animals on the farm. His compassion, determination and authenticity resonated deeply with viewers across the country. After weeks of intense competition, he emerged as the winner of the series, securing one of the most celebrated victories in the programme's history and transforming himself into a household name throughout Brazil. Born in Brighton, East Sussex, Saffron Barker displayed a creative spirit from an early age. Before social media became her profession, she explored music as a member of the girl group Born2Blush, discovering an early passion for performing before live audiences. Although the group enjoyed modest success, it was evident that her greatest strength lay not solely in music, but in her natural ability to connect with people. That gift would soon find its ideal platform as YouTube began reshaping the entertainment industry. Launching her YouTube channel in 2015, Saffron entered an increasingly competitive digital landscape with content centred on fashion, beauty, lifestyle and everyday experiences. Rather than relying upon sensationalism or controversy, she cultivated an audience through warmth, relatability and consistency. Her viewers did not simply consume her videos; they grew alongside her, witnessing every milestone from adolescence into adulthood. As her audience expanded into the millions, she became one of the defining British creators of her generation, demonstrating that authenticity could be as compelling as spectacle. Success online soon opened opportunities well beyond social media. In 2017 she published her autobiographical book, Saffron Barker vs Real Life, offering readers a candid glimpse behind the carefully filtered world of internet fame. Rather than presenting an image of perfection, she explored the pressures, insecurities and lessons that accompanied growing up in public. The publication reinforced her reputation for honesty, allowing followers to see not merely the influencer, but the young woman navigating extraordinary visibility while remaining remarkably grounded. The same year also marked another important milestone as she partnered with Primark to launch her own lifestyle and homeware collection. The collaboration demonstrated that her influence extended beyond digital engagement into commercial success. Fashion, stationery and home décor bearing her name quickly reached consumers across the United Kingdom, illustrating that audiences trusted not only her recommendations but also her personal sense of style. It represented one of the earliest examples of British creators successfully translating online popularity into enduring retail partnerships. Yet perhaps the defining chapter of her public career arrived in 2019 when she joined Strictly Come Dancing. At only nineteen years of age, she became one of the programme’s youngest contestants, introducing herself to audiences far beyond social media. Week after week she demonstrated resilience, discipline and determination while embracing one of British television’s most demanding competitions. Although she did not lift the Glitterball Trophy, her performances earned admiration and broadened her appeal across multiple generations of viewers. That same year, The Sunday Times recognised her as Britain’s leading female influencer, affirming her place among the country’s most significant digital personalities. She approached acting not with vanity, but with fascination. Long before Hollywood arrived, British television became the training ground that quietly sharpened her craft. Series such as My Mad Fat Diary, Doctor Foster, and Thirteen revealed a young actress capable of carrying enormous emotional weight with remarkable subtlety. Even in supporting roles, there was something impossible to ignore about her screen presence. She understood silence instinctively. She understood tension. Most importantly, she understood people. Then came Killing Eve. It is impossible to discuss Jodie Comer’s cultural impact without acknowledging the seismic effect of her portrayal of Villanelle. What could have easily become a one dimensional assassin evolved into one of the most mesmerising characters modern television has produced. Villanelle was terrifying, childish, seductive, lonely, glamorous, violent, emotionally wounded, and darkly funny all at once. In lesser hands, the contradictions would have collapsed. In Jodie’s hands, they became hypnotic. The performance transformed her career overnight, but more importantly, it transformed public understanding of what female characters could be allowed to embody onscreen. Villanelle was not written to be morally digestible or emotionally convenient. She existed outside traditional expectations of femininity entirely, and Jodie embraced that chaos fearlessly. In Help, her devastating portrayal of a care worker during the Covid pandemic stripped away every layer of glamour and performance. The role demanded raw emotional realism rather than charisma, and Jodie delivered one of the most emotionally painful performances of her career. There was no vanity in it whatsoever. Only truth. Similarly, her work in theatre further proved the depth of her abilities. Performing a one woman play such as Prima Facie required not only technical brilliance, but extraordinary emotional endurance. Carrying an entire production alone night after night demands a level of discipline and vulnerability few actors can sustain. Critics and audiences alike recognised the performance as career defining. It was not merely impressive. It felt culturally important.
